Greetings Ms. Junker,

Thank you for taking time to reach out and express your concern.

First and foremost, I wanted to clarify that Kingdom Management is not the homeowners association (HOA) to which your unit belongs. Kingdom Management is the management company of your condo association.

As the management company, we take our job of protecting your property values very seriously and know that often requires asking all residents to bring their homes into compliance with the association’s governing documents. At this time, we are aware that you are in an active lawsuit with the condo association for numerous violations to the governing documents.

To ensure equal treatment of all residents, Florida law requires your association to enforce all violations of the association’s governing documents to which all residents must agree when they move into their units.

Knowing this, the board has decided to pursue your violations. It is important to note that Kingdom Management did not vote on this decision.

This is a matter between Ms. Junker and the board. Furthermore, because this is a legal matter, we here at Kingdom Management are not at liberty to discuss this further.

My experience with Kingdom Management is nothing short of a living hell. We lived in Florida years ago when my husband was stationed in Jacksonville.in all my experience with HOA management companies in Florida and the various states in which we lived, I can confidently state that Kingdom Management is the most absurdly unprofessional.

Issues with Kingdom Management began a few months after they were hired as the newest management company. Our HOA checks would be returned due to Kingdom Management's frequent address changes. Our payments were set to autopay through our credit union so, we would update the information, and a check would be reissued, and months later, the process would repeat. The "guess the new location game" was exasperating; moreover, we were unsure if the payment was made until sometime later. To circumvent further issues, I began to make online payments through the Kingdom Management site via BB&T.
In early 2019, I received a letter from a law firm on behalf of Kingdom Management to collect any unpaid balance. A lien was placed on my property, and I was thoroughly confused. Apparently, Kingdom Management failed to send the end of the year annual invoice and then referred me to a collection company for a bill I never received, which cost me thousands.
We have never received consistent invoices from Kingdom Management. The online bill pay is a very basic site, where a user clicks a box to indicate Jan-Dec fee, which opens another box to impute a payment amount. After a payment method is entered, and submit the transaction is complete. There is nothing displayed on the screen to indicate a monthly fee, nor balances.
Around April 2019, in typical nonsensical fashion, Kingdom Management sending one sporadic invoice for a bill paid monthly. I noticed that some payments were not reflected on the account. The HOA assesses monthly fees and annual fees; both accounts are managed through Kingdom Management and paid through BB&T. I took the fault for this - thinking I inadvertently made the monthly payment to the incorrect account, I contacted Kingdom Management. I was told the account would be reviewed, and any residual payments would be applied to the correct account.
